The Benefits of Tooth Extractions
Protect Your Oral Health
Removing a damaged or infected tooth prevents further complications and protects your overall health.
Prevent Crowding & Misalignment
Extractions create space when needed, helping to avoid bite problems and orthodontic issues.
Relieve Pain & Discomfort
A severely decayed or infected tooth can cause ongoing pain. Extraction provides lasting relief.

Our Treatment Process
Comprehensive Consultation
Dr. Jagow will assess your tooth and overall oral health to determine if extraction is the best option. We’ll review your X-rays, discuss alternatives, and make sure you feel confident about your treatment plan.
Gentle Tooth Removal
On the day of your procedure, we ensure maximum comfort with local anesthesia or sedation if needed. Using modern, minimally invasive techniques, we carefully extract the tooth with as little impact as possible to surrounding tissue.
Aftercare & Healing
We provide personalized aftercare instructions to promote fast healing. You’ll get guidance on pain management, diet modifications, and hygiene tips to keep your recovery on track. If a replacement option like a dental implant is needed, we’ll discuss the next steps.

With modern anesthesia and gentle techniques, most patients feel little to no discomfort during the procedure. We also offer sedation options to ensure a stress-free experience.
Most patients recover within a few days to a week. We’ll provide detailed aftercare instructions to help minimize swelling and discomfort.
If needed, we’ll discuss dental implants, bridges, or partial dentures to restore your smile after healing. Keeping your bite balanced and functional is our priority.
